Why AI Automation Matters for Small‑Scale Entertainment Venues

Entertainment venues such as go‑kart tracks operate on thin margins. Every hour of idle track time, every missed maintenance alert, or every inefficient staff schedule directly impacts the bottom line. Traditional manual processes—paper logs, spreadsheets, phone‑based reservations—are prone to human error and scale poorly as demand fluctuates.

AI offers three core advantages:

  • Predictive insights: Anticipate demand spikes, equipment failures, and staffing needs before they happen.
  • Process automation: Reduce repetitive tasks such as booking confirmations, inventory checks, and billing.
  • Personalized customer experiences: Tailor promotions and loyalty programs based on real‑time data, increasing repeat visits.

When combined, these capabilities generate tangible cost savings while unlocking new revenue streams.

Key Areas Where AI Can Transform a Hialeah Go‑Kart Track

1. Dynamic Pricing and Demand Forecasting

Hialeah’s climate encourages year‑round outdoor activities, but demand still varies by day of the week, weather, and local events. An AI‑driven pricing engine can analyze historical sales, weather forecasts, and nearby event calendars to suggest optimal price points for each hour.

Actionable tip: Integrate a cloud‑based AI model (e.g., Azure Machine Learning or Google Vertex AI) with your booking platform. Start with a simple regression model that predicts hourly foot traffic based on temperature and day‑of‑week, then gradually layer in more variables like school holidays or nearby concert schedules.

Result: A modest 10‑15% price adjustment during peak hours can increase average ticket revenue by $2,000–$3,000 per month without adding extra staff.

2. Predictive Maintenance for Karts and Track Equipment

Unexpected breakdowns halt operations and lead to costly repairs. By attaching IoT sensors to kart engines, brakes, and track safety systems, AI can detect anomalies—such as vibration patterns or temperature spikes—well before a failure occurs.

Practical example: The Miami Speed Zone installed vibration sensors on 12 of its 20 karts. An AI model flagged a subtle increase in engine vibration on one kart, prompting a pre‑emptive engine check that revealed a worn bearing. The issue was fixed during a scheduled shift change, avoiding a week‑long downtime that would have cost roughly $4,000 in lost sales.

Implementation steps:

  1. Choose affordable sensors (e.g., Bluetooth Low Energy accelerometers).
  2. Set up a data ingestion pipeline to a cloud storage service.
  3. Train an anomaly‑detection model using historical sensor data.
  4. Configure automated alerts to the maintenance manager’s mobile device.

3. Automated Scheduling and Labor Management

Staffing a go‑kart track involves cashiers, safety monitors, mechanics, and cleaning crews. Over‑staffing drives labor costs, while understaffing hurts customer safety and satisfaction.

An AI‑based scheduling tool can match labor supply to predicted demand, taking into account employee availability, skill levels, and labor regulations. The tool can also recommend cross‑training opportunities to maximize workforce flexibility.

4. Optimized Inventory and Retail Management

Beyond ticket sales, many tracks sell merchandise, food, and beverage items. AI can forecast which items will sell best during specific shifts, ensuring shelves are stocked appropriately and waste is minimized.

Tip for owners: Use a simple demand‑forecasting model (e.g., Prophet by Facebook) that weighs past sales against variables like temperature, day of the week, and promotional activity. Connect it to your POS to auto‑generate purchase orders for high‑turnover items.

5. Personalized Marketing and Loyalty Programs

AI can segment customers by behavior—frequency of visits, spend per visit, preference for group bookings, etc.—and deliver targeted promotions via email or SMS. Personalization boosts repeat bookings and increases average spend.

Step‑by‑Step Guide to Implementing AI Automation at Your Track

Step 1: Define Clear Business Objectives

Start with measurable goals such as:

  • Reduce equipment downtime by 20% in six months.
  • Increase average daily ticket revenue by 12% using dynamic pricing.
  • Cut labor overtime costs by 15% through AI scheduling.

Specific objectives help you select the right AI tools and set realistic KPIs.

Step 2: Assess Existing Data Infrastructure

AI needs data. Conduct an audit of:

  • Point‑of‑sale transaction logs.
  • Staff shift rosters and attendance records.
  • Equipment sensor data (if any).
  • Customer contact information and engagement history.

If data is stored in spreadsheets, consider migrating to a cloud database (e.g., AWS RDS or Google Cloud SQL) to enable smoother integration.

Step 3: Choose a Scalable AI Platform

For small to medium businesses, managed services lower the technical barrier. Look for platforms offering pre‑built models for:

  • Time‑series forecasting (e.g., Azure Forecast, Amazon Forecast).
  • Anomaly detection (e.g., Google Cloud Anomaly Detection).
  • Optimization (e.g., IBM Decision Optimization).

These services often provide drag‑and‑drop interfaces, making it possible for a non‑technical owner to prototype solutions.

Step 4: Pilot One Use Case
(e.g., Predictive Maintenance)

Begin with a low‑risk pilot:

  1. Install sensors on 5 of your most‑used karts.
  2. Collect data for 30 days.
  3. Train an anomaly‑detection model and set alert thresholds.
  4. Measure downtime before and after implementing AI alerts.

Document results and use the success story to obtain buy‑in for broader deployments.

Step 5: Scale and Integrate

After a successful pilot, expand the solution to cover all equipment, integrate pricing and scheduling models, and link AI insights to your dashboard tools (e.g., Power BI or Looker). Ensure that each new model aligns with the original business objectives and KPIs.

Step 6: Train Your Team and Establish Governance

Even the best AI system fails without proper human oversight. Provide training sessions for managers on interpreting AI alerts and adjusting operations accordingly. Set up a governance framework that defines data privacy, model monitoring, and periodic performance reviews.

Tips for Hialeah Business Owners Considering AI Integration

  • Start small and iterate. A focused pilot reduces risk and provides quick wins.
  • Leverage local partnerships. Universities such as Florida International University have data‑science programs that can assist with model development at reduced cost.
  • Prioritize data quality. Clean, well‑structured data is the foundation of any successful AI project.
  • Stay compliant. Ensure customer data handling follows Florida’s privacy regulations and the GDPR if you serve international tourists.
  • Measure continuously. Use a dashboard to track KPIs like downtime, labor cost per hour, and average ticket price.
